Qubetics’ DPoS Model and Staking Infrastructure
Qubetics operates on a Delegated Proof of Stake (DPoS) consensus mechanism, engineered for speed, efficiency, and democratic governance. In this model, token holders use their stake to vote for trusted delegates, who validate transactions and produce blocks in a rotating schedule. This method ensures high throughput and faster finality compared to traditional PoW or standard PoS models.
Token holders can choose to participate as validators by staking 25,000 TICS or as delegators with a minimum of 5,000 TICS. Delegators receive a share of the 30% APY rewards distributed by the validators they support. The system also fosters transparent governance and energy-efficient performance.
The DPoS architecture allows for reduced latency, robust network participation, and enhanced security through decentralized voting, all while maintaining scalability. This creates a practical and powerful structure for long-term platform growth.
